Counsel for your life. · 5:25pm Oct 7th, 2012

I've been dealing with a lot of problems lately, both of my own making and due to the choices of others. It would be far too easy to give up or give into depression. As I've been struggling through the various issues that present themselves, there are a few pieces of advice that always return to my mind. I'd like to share these snippets of wisdom with you all. I hope that the religious tones of this don't offend you. In fact, I do hope that you will let the spirit of this message into your heart and ponder on the words.

I want to share with you a vehicle, an instrument that I developed some time ago for myself and for my family. It can assist us as we read the suggested vision of true discipleship as [followers of Christ]. It helps when we, from time to time, ponder and seek identification with the following thoughts:

Embrace this day with an enthusiastic welcome, no matter how it looks. The covenant with God to which you are true enables you to be enlightened by Him, and nothing is impossible for you.

When you are physically sick, tired, or in despair, steer your thoughts away from yourself and direct them in gratitude and love toward God.

In your life there have to be challenges. They will either bring you closer to God, and therefore make you stronger or they can destroy you. But you make the decision of which road you take.

First and foremost, you are a spirit child of God. If you neglect to feed your spirit, you will reap unhappiness. Don't permit anything to detract you from this awareness.

You cannot communicate with God unless you have first sacrificed your self-oriented natural man, and have brought yourself into the lower levels of meekness, to become acceptable for the light of Christ.

Put all frustrations, hurt feelings, and grumblings into the perspective of your eternal hope. Light will flow into your soul.

Pause to ponder the suffering Christ felt in the Garden of Gethsemane. In the awareness of the depth of gratitude for Him, you appreciate every opportunity to show your love for him by diligently serving in His church.

God knows that you are not perfect. As you suffer about your imperfections, He will give you comfort and suggestions where to improve. God knows better than you what you need. He always attempts to speak to you. Listen and follow the uncomfortable suggestions that He makes to you, and everything will fall into its place.

Avoid any fear like your worst enemy, but magnify your fear about the consequences of sin.

When you cannot love someone, look into that person's eyes, long enough to find the hidden rudiments of the child of God within him.

Never judge anyone. When you accept this, you will be freed. In the case of your own children or subordinates, where you have the responsibility to judge, help them to become their own judges.

If someone hurts you so much that your feelings seem to choke you, forgive and you will be free again. Avoid at all costs any pessimistic, negative, or criticizing thoughts. If you cannot cut them out, they will do you harm.

On the road to salvation, let questions arise but never doubts. If something is wrong, God will give you clarity, but never doubts.

Avoid rush and haste and uncontrolled words. Divine light develops in places of peace and quiet. Be aware of that as you enter into places of worship.

Be not so much concerned about what you do. But what you do, do with all your heart, mind, and strength... in thoroughness there is satisfaction.

You want to be good and to do good. That is commendable. But the greatest achievement that can be reached in our lives is to be under the complete influence of the Holy Ghost. Then He will teach us what is good and necessary to do.

The pain of sacrifice lasts only one moment. It is the fear of pain of sacrifice that makes you hesitate to do it.

Be grateful for every opportunity you have to serve: it helps you more than those you serve.

And finally, when you are compelled to give something up or when things that are dear to you are withdrawn from you, know that this is your lesson to be learned right now. But know also that as you are learning this lesson God wants to give you something better.

Thus we prepare all the days of our lives, and as we grow, death loses its sting, hell loses its power, and we look forward to that day with anticipation and joy when He will come in His glory.

-Elder Enzio F. Busche
